The action is swift and immediate, instantly plunging Lucy and Boone into a run for their lives from an unknown pursuer. Lucy is a social worker who has temporary custody of Boone, a young boy whose parents were attacked, with one dead and the other in a coma. Lucy does not like the forest (a girl after my own heart) but she is willing to fight her fears to protect young Boone from danger as they are attacked while driving through Sumter National Forest. Noah, a forest ranger who loves the woods, comes upon the pair and is thankfully able and willing to help them run from the danger.
The characters are truly what sets this novel apart from the rest of the Love Inspired Suspense novels. I cannot even begin to imagine the emotions that are coursing through poor Boone. To have your father murdered in cold blood, and your mother in a coma fighting for her life, all while being chased by someone that wants to harm or kill you…that is heavy! Then factor in his young age and it is almost too unbelievable to fathom. What I loved the most about this novel was that the three main players are not related in any form, yet they all have this automatic protectiveness for one another. With the selfishness that abounds in our culture I found this fact immensely satisfying.
Though you feel like you’re catching this story in the middle of the narrative I never once felt lost. My mind whirled with the question, “Why?” a lot, wondering who would do something like this to innocent people, especially with one of them being such a young child. These questions spurred me on, to the point that I had a hard time putting this novel down.
I truly enjoyed this novel so much and love how the author was able to paint such a vivid narrative that instantly drew me in and kept me riveted until the end. The thread of faith throughout is uplifting and the ending is satisfying. It is the perfect ending to this clean suspenseful read.
